Dali Tour Details

We will meet up at Plaça de Sant Feliu in Girona at 8:30 am and head to Figueres. This is the town where the famous surrealist artist Salvador Dalí was born. Dalí constructed his own museum over the remains of the old theatre of Figueres, where he displayed the numerous works of art he created throughout his life.

For around two hours, we will explore the Dalí Theatre-Museum, discovering the artist's most renowned works including Port Alguer, Muchacha de Figueres, La Cesta de Pan, and Galarina, among many others.

Once you have seen the artist's creations, we will proceed to the locations that marked his life. Our first stop is Cadaqués, where Dalí spent his summer holidays as a child. This charming fishing village on the stunning Costa Brava greatly influenced the artist, a fact reflected in the works he produced during his youth.

We will continue our tour at Cap de Creus. This magnificent natural park is characterized by its windswept, craggy landscapes and hidden coves with deep blue waters. This area inspired Dalí's life and work, and we will view the exterior of the home he established in the bay of Port Lligat.

Afterwards, we'll return to Cadaqués, one of the most picturesque villages on the Costa Brava. Here, we'll go on a guided tour to learn about local pirate and sailor legends, and visit the Church of Santa Maria, which houses one of the town's most cherished treasures.

Finally, we'll return to Girona, where we expect to arrive between 6 pm and 6:30 pm.
